Anyone experience in using module compiler to create a custom register file from some specialized regfile cells in the standard-cell library (eg. UMC lib)?

Some memory compilers cannot generate memories of very small configurations, eg. 8X32 or 16X16. I was thinking of whether Module Compiler can be configured to use specialized cells(Register File cells) available in the standard-cell library and generate them that are area and timing efficient, expecially if there are large number of instances (eg. 128 8X32 synchronous read/write regfile). Testing of the series of regile will be done using a shared-BIST. Using F/Fs to implement the regfile may not be area efficient.
